Eric Comes to School

By Sharon Doherty | Project Leader

Eric arrived to school with his father Paulino for the first time this year last Thursday. It was obvious that both were excited and very pleased to be there. All at school were also very pleased to have Eric back as he is a special child who, although profoundly deaf, engages most around him. Eric immediately joined his fellow pre-school friends in class. Maricruz, a very expressive seven-year-old, was particularly pleased to see Eric back at school. With a big smile on her face she held up four fingers to indicate that this morning there were four children in their pre-school class!

Another particularly comical moment occurred later when lunch was served. Eric looked at his bowl of soup and, perhaps thinking that it looked a bit hot, began blowing on the small soup bowl to cool it off. The other three children watched Eric quizzically for a few seconds, then looking one to another, they all began blowing on their own bowl of soup! Too cute!

Paulino was provided the help he needed to pay for bus fares to bring him and Eric to San Miguel de Allende from Dolores Hidalgo, 25 miles away and an approximate one hour bus ride, two days each week. Although we had hoped for Eric to come three days each week, all agreed that this would be a good place to start. Twice a week to school is within Paulino’s comfort level considering his work and other family obligations. We feel confident that starting slow and working up to more days is the best way forward. It has been our experience that the answer to a challenge will often present itself at the appropriate time, all that is needed from us is patience.

Thank you to all who have made this project possible; bringing Eric to participate in pre-school and to learn Mexican Sign Language. We will continue to keep you updated in the future as Eric continues to grow and thrive at Escuela de Educación Especial.
